Steve, the only big difference is in the ignition and cams. If its a
85-89 then you have the two pick ups and a different black box. Some 90
& 91 I've seen also have this. There aren't any major differences in the
rest of the bike. Turn signal relay, starter relay, the wiring harness,
but the motor is still the same heavy lump from 85. The 85 & 86 did have
stronger cams, but thats about it. The Euro early version didn't have
the v-boost. The Canadian models have adjustable needle position. Be
happy, keep the oil changed, and don't try to keep up with a Busa on the
big end.
